This small winery (annual production 2,700 cases) produces Red Meritage, a proprietary blend of Cabernet and Merlot grapes. With a Wine Advocate rating of 95+ and accolades calling it a profound wine, a stop here may be worth your while. The 170 acres of the estate vineyards have three separate viticultural areas. The Oakville vineyard in the valley floor is certified organic and grows mostly Merlot grapes. The Howell Mountain and Mt. Veeder vineyards, located at altitudes of more than 1,000 feet, are primarily planted with Cabernet Sauvignon grapes used in producing wines for sister labels Lakoya and Atalon. Far Niente functioned as a gravity flow winery till the onset of prohibition. It was in disuse for 60 years and opened again in 1979. Far Niente believes in quality and therefore produce one Chardonnay and one Cabernet Sauvignon of the highest quality, luxury and elegance. If the wine does not meet expectations, then it does not make the final blend. Both the wines are premium wines and much sought after by the connoisseurs of California and beyond. Visitors are welcome and guided tours are offered several times during the day. You would need to call ahead if you want to go on a tour of their tri-level winery, the storage caves and the carriage house which has a large collection of classic and vintage automobiles. This is NOT the Mondavi Winery, rather it is what used to be the Vichon Winery, acquired in 1985 by the Mondavi family and Associates. The new name was bestowed upon the winery in 1997 to reflect its production focus: all Italian varietals like sangiovese, nebbiolo, moscato bianco and barbera. The winery has a spectacular panoramic view of the Napa Valley. The grounds are nicely landscaped and tables can be reserved for $25 (includes a bottle of wine) at the popular picnic area. Nickel and Nickel is well known for its collection of vineyards and single-vineyard wines. Established in 1997, they have wines that include a fusion of some of the rarest single-vineyard wines. Experience and skill are present to ensure that the customer may be able to understand the terroir and the land of where the wine is being made from. Robert Mondavi is one of the most renowned vintners in Napa County, producing affordable and complex wines. The winery offers several tasting tours varying in depth and price. The Taste of Wine is a 2-hour formal tasting dedicated to training your palate as learning about various wine characteristics. Reservations are required all tours and tastings.
